One of the key aspects of income protection insurance is that it provides a replacement income if the policyholder is unable to work due to illness or injury This means that if the policyholder becomes sick or injured and is unable to work for an extended period of time, they can receive a portion of their income through their insurance policy The amount of income replacement typically ranges from 50% to 70% of the policyholder’s regular income This coverage helps to alleviate financial stress during challenging times and ensures that individuals can continue to meet their financial obligations.
Income protection insurance typically covers a wide range of illnesses and injuries that prevent individuals from working These may include conditions such as cancer, heart disease, mental health disorders, back injuries, and many others In some cases, coverage may also extend to disabilities that are not related to illnesses or injuries, such as chronic conditions that impact an individual’s ability to work It is important to carefully review the policy details to understand exactly what is covered and what is excluded from the coverage.

It is important to note that income protection insurance does not cover every possible scenario that may prevent an individual from working There are certain exclusions and limitations to coverage that policyholders should be aware of For example, most policies do not cover pre-existing conditions, self-inflicted injuries, or injuries sustained while participating in high-risk activities Additionally, there is typically a waiting period before benefits are paid out, which can range from 30 days to several months depending on the policy Policyholders should carefully review their policy documents to understand the specific terms and conditions of their coverage.
When considering income protection insurance, it is important to weigh the costs of coverage against the potential benefits Premiums for income protection insurance can vary depending on factors such as age, occupation, health status, and the level of coverage chosen While income protection insurance can be a valuable safety net for individuals who rely on their income, it is essential to assess whether the cost of coverage is feasible within your budget.
